American Recovery and Reinvestment Act-Implementation of the Advanced Metering Infrastructure Requirements for Planning, Contractor's Performance, and 'Reporting Was Ineffective

Abstract

We are providing this report for review and comment. Naval Facilities Engineering Command Southwest officials did not have effective controls over the planning, contractor's performance, and reporting of the Advanced Metering Infrastructure project, vallied at $24.8 million. As a result, Navy lacks reasonable assurance that $24.8 million of Recovery Act funds were appropriately justified and the installation of the meters was properly planned. We considered management comments on a draft of this report when preparing the final report.
